Key Responsibilities
- Conduct pre-demolition inspections to assess site readiness and compliance requirements
- Verify service disconnections and isolation of power, gas, water and other utilities
- Identify hazards including structural risks, access issues, asbestos concerns and environmental considerations
- Coordinate asbestos sampling and assist with site preparation requirements where required
- Ensure all permits, approvals and site documentation are in place before works commence
- Conduct post-demolition inspections to verify works have been completed safely and to company standards
- Identify defects, incomplete works or compliance issues and coordinate corrective actions
- Complete inspection reports, site records and compliance documentation
- Liaise with project managers, supervisors, site crews, clients and regulatory authorities as required
- Assist in maintaining Burton Demolition’s commitment to safety, quality and regulatory compliance
